Choose the most suitable option to replace the highlighted part of the sentence: Neither the teacher nor the students was present in the hall.
- was not present
- were also present
- were present
- was also not present
Correct answer: were present
Solution
In a neither-nor construction, the verb agrees with the subject closest to it. Since "students" is plural, the correct verb is "were". The sentence should read: "Neither the teacher nor the students were present in the hall."
